According to Stratistics MRC, the Global Tamper-Evident Smart Packaging Market is accounted for $2.4 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ach $4.9 billion by 2032 growing at a CAGR of 10.7% during the forecast period. Tamper-evident smart packaging refers to packaging solutions designed to show visible or digital evidence if a product has been interfered with, ensuring safety, authenticity, and consumer trust. Integrating advanced technologies such as QR codes, RFID/NFC tags, sensors, or blockchain, it not only prevents unauthorized access but also provides real-time information about the product’s condition, storage, and handling. Widely used in pharmaceuticals, food, and high-value consumer goods, this packaging enhances supply chain transparency, combats counterfeiting, and supports regulatory compliance. By combining security features with smart technology, it protects both brands and consumers while enabling data-driven insights.

Restraint:

High implementation and production costs

Companies face significant expenses in deploying authentication labels, IoT sensors, and advanced sealing technologies. Smaller manufacturers struggle to justify investments due to limited budgets and uncertain ROI. Maintenance and integration with existing packaging lines add further financial burden. Price-sensitive markets are slower to adopt advanced tamper-evident solutions despite proven safety benefits. Limited economies of scale constrain affordability improvements. This restraint continues to restrict mass adoption across diverse industries.

Threat:

Integration challenges with existing supply chains

Companies struggle to retrofit legacy systems with advanced authentication and monitoring technologies. Inconsistent global standards create interoperability issues across regions. Logistics providers face difficulties in managing diverse packaging formats and verification systems. Regulatory uncertainty further complicates adoption in cross-border supply chains. Limited technical expertise among operators reduces efficiency and confidence. This threat continues to constrain long-term adoption despite rising demand for secure packaging.

Key Developments:

In October 2025, Avery Dennison partnered with Walmart to deploy RFID-enabled packaging solutions that enhance freshness and operational efficiency. These smart labels also serve tamper-evident functions, ensuring product authenticity and safety across food and retail supply chains.

In August 2023, Amcor entered into an agreement to acquire Phoenix Flexibles in Gujarat, India, strengthening its flexible packaging portfolio for food, home care, and personal care. This collaboration enhances Amcor’s ability to deliver tamper-evident and sustainable packaging solutions in high-growth Asian markets.
